The People Score for the Overall Health Score in 80002, Arvada, Colorado is 19 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.
An estimate of 89.35 percent of the residents in 80002 has some form of health insurance. 31.98 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 67.21 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 80002 would have to travel an average of 1.80 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Lutheran Medical Center. In a 20-mile radius, there are 22,481 healthcare providers accessible to residents living in 80002, Arvada, Colorado.
